Subject: Quickstore 4.2 — bloom filter now fronts the KV layer

Plugin authors: starting with this release, Quickstore places a bloom filter ahead of the key-value store. Negative lookups return faster; false positives fall through safely. No API changes are required on your side. Verify your plugin against the staging build referenced below.

session token of fahif-tadup = htk3_9c7

Subject: SnackRoute handover

Hey Mirela,

Taking over release duties for SnackRoute, the vending-machine restock planner, while I'm out. The 4.2 branch is frozen; only the depot-priority hotfix is pending. Build pipeline is green, QA signed off Tuesday. Deploys go through the usual staging gate, nothing fancy. You'll need the deploy key for the release host, so here it is.

deploy key for kaduf-bagep: bky6_NNeq4d

## Rate Limiting

All plugin traffic into the Corvanet gateway is subject to tiered rate limits, evaluated per key and per route. Plugins default to 120 requests per minute; burst allowances are documented in the `limits.yaml` reference. Exceeding a tier returns a 429 with a `Retry-After` header, which your plugin must honor. To test your plugin against the sandbox gateway, authenticate with the sandbox service key:

service key, kaduf-bawig: kto15_Ze79S0dligTw0yO